SEEM Collaborative's Program for Deaf and Hard of Hearing students is seeking to fill the position of Speech Language Pathologist.
Qualifications: Master’s degree in speech-language pathology, certified by the American Speech-Language and Hearing Association, public school certification and licensed in Massachusetts to practice. May be in the process of completing clinical fellowship year under the supervision of a certified speech-language pathologist.
CCC-SLP or CF-SLP credential requirement with experience in language, speech and auditory development of children with hearing loss preferred.
